6-Flame Roll-out Limit S47
Flame roll-out limit S47 is a SPST N.C. high temperature
limit located as shown in figure 19. S47 is wired to the A55
Unit Controller. When S47 senses flame roll-out (indicating
a blockage in the combustion air passages), the flame roll-
out limit trips and the ignition control immediately closes the
gas valve.
Limit S47 is factory preset to open at 290_F +
12_F
(143.3_C +
6.7_C) on a temperature rise. All flame roll-out
limits are manual reset.
7-Combustion Air Prove Switch S18
S18 is a SPST N.O. switch which monitors combustion air
inducer operation. See figure 19 for location. Switch S18 is
wired to the A55 Unit Controller.
The switch closes on a negative pressure fall. This negative
pressure fall and switch actuation allows the ignition se
quence to continue (proves, by closing, that the combus
tion air inducer is operating before allowing the gas valve to
open.) The combustion air prove switch is factory set and
not adjustable. The switch will automatically open on a
pressure rise (less negative pressure). S18 closes at 0.25 +
5 in.w.c. (62.3 + 12.4 Pa) and opens at 0.10 + 5 in.w.c. (24.8
+
12.4Pa)
8-Combustion Air Inducer B6
The combustion air inducer provides fresh air to the burner
while clearing the combustion chamber of exhaust gases.
See figure 19 for the inducer location. The inducer is ener
gized by the A55 Unit Controller via K13 relay.
The inducer uses a 208/230V single‐phase PSC motor and
a 4.81in. x 1.25in. (122mm x 32mm) blower wheel. The mo
tor operates at 3200RPM and is equipped with auto‐reset
overload protection. Blower is supplied by various manu
facturers. Ratings may vary by manufacturer. Specific
blower electrical ratings can be found on the unit rating
plate.
All combustion air blower motors are sealed and cannot be
oiled. The blower cannot be adjusted but can be disassem
bled for cleaning.
9-Combustion Air Motor Capacitor C3
Combustion air inducer B6 requires a run capacitor rated at
3 MFD and 370VAC.
10-Gas Valves GV1
Gas valve GV1 is a two‐stage redundant valve.. On first
stage (low fire) is quick opening (on and off in less than 3
seconds). Second stage is slow opening (on to high fire
pressure in 40 seconds and off to low fire pressure in 30
seconds). On a call for first stage heat (low fire), the valve is
energized by the ignition control simultaneously with the
spark electrode. On a call for second stage heat (high fire),
the second stage operator is energized directly from A55.
The valve is adjustable for high fire only. Low fire is not ad
justable. A manual shut-off knob is provided on the valve for
shut-off. Manual shut‐off knob immediately closes both
stages without delay. Figure 20 shows gas valve compo
nents. Table 7 shows factory gas valve regulation for LGT
units.
